#4c66b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c66b0 is composed of 29.8% red, 40%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 224.4 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 49.4%. #4c66b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ccff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#4c66b0 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#4c66b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c66b0 has RGB values of R:76, G:102,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5007024.

Shades and Tints of #4c66b0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070c is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c66b0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7d80 is the less saturated color, while #0845f4 is the most saturated one.
